Fairpointe Capital's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Fairpointe Capital held 80 positions worth $686M, up 2.7% from $668M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Fairpointe Capital withdrew a net $94.3M in Q2 2020, closing 6 positions and reducing 40 holdings. Its most notable exit was ManpowerGroup, an estimated $5.35M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 21%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

Against the trend, Fairpointe Capital opened a new position in Nokia worth $8.68M.
